WebApr 4, 2024 · 101. 1. Generally clustering based on a time variable is possible, yes. However, you should consider what level of granularity you want to consider, as the results will be different if you cluster the activity based on time of day, day of week, month of year and so forth. – deemel. WebDec 1, 2024 · A method is presented to detect and locate user-defined patterns in time series data. The method is based on decomposing time series into a sequence of fixed-length snapshots on which a classifier is applied. Snapshot classification results determine the exact position of the pattern. Inherent in the collection of data taken over time is some form of random variation. Smoothing data removes or reduces random variation and shows underlying trends and cyclic components. npr redistrictingWebMay 25, 2016 · The range of time-series data can be continuous & real-valued, discrete, or even non-numeric.
